Israel to Free Jailed Militants

World | July 27, 2003, Sunday // 00:00

Israel's cabinet has voted to release up to 100 Hamas and Islamic Jihad prisoners. Ministers voted by 14-9 to authorise the release of the militants, which is seen as a goodwill gesture toward the Palestinians ahead of Prime Minster Ariel Sharon's visit to Washington this week. US President George W Bush met Palestinian Prime Minister Mahmoud Abbas - also known as Abu Mazen - on Friday. Bush wants both sides to fulfil their commitments under the "road map" peace plan, which aims to bring an end to violence and establish a Palestinian state by 2005. At a cabinet meeting two weeks ago Sharon said releases would be confined to members of Palestinian movements who had not been involved in acts of violence.
